Local Clinics & Sensory Resources in Princeton
Penn Medicine Princeton Health
Penn Medicine's central New Jersey hospital offering inpatient and outpatient rehabilitation, occupational therapy, physical therapy, and behavioral health — the primary referral center for Mercer County's therapy workforce.
Princeton Public Schools – Special Education
The district's special education department coordinates IEP-driven therapy services, sensory accommodations, and school-based OT and counseling for K–12 students across Princeton's public schools.
Princeton University – Psychology & Neuroscience
Princeton's Department of Psychology and Princeton Neuroscience Institute conduct cutting-edge research in cognitive science, developmental psychology, and neuroscience — contributing to the region's research-informed clinical culture.
Princeton Pediatric Therapy
Private pediatric therapy practice providing occupational therapy, physical therapy, and developmental services for children with sensory processing challenges, autism, and motor delays in the Princeton and Mercer County area.
Autism New Jersey – Mercer County
Autism New Jersey connects Mercer County families to ASD resources, provider directories, support groups, and advocacy — serving as one of the nation's most comprehensive state-level autism organizations.
NJ Early Intervention System – Mercer County
New Jersey's Part C early-intervention program providing developmental screening, therapy services, and family coaching for children birth to three through Mercer County service coordinators.
Mercer County ABA Providers
Applied behavior analysis providers offering clinic-based and in-home ABA therapy for children on the autism spectrum across Mercer County, supported by New Jersey's comprehensive autism insurance mandate.
Princeton Center for Leadership Training
Nonprofit providing youth development, peer leadership, and mental health support programs for adolescents across Mercer County — connecting therapy professionals with community-based youth services.
